Quoting dfoulkes:

-- What safe-mode does ..... Safe Mode temporarily affects the following:
* All extensions are disabled. --- * The userChrome.css and userContent.css files are ignored.
* The default theme is used, without a persona. --- * The default toolbar layout is used.
* The Just-in-time (JIT) JavaScript compiler is disabled. --- * Hardware acceleration is disabled.

-- Safe Mode has no effect on the following --
* The status of plugins is not affected.
* Custom preferences are not affected.

If you have any corruption (some might be unnoticeable) in your bookmarks file it may produce unexpected results.

To clean up bookmarks (it is an HTML file) you can use Composer in SeaMonkey,
KompoZer standalone https://sourceforge.net/projects/kompozer/
Geany https://geany.en.softonic.com/download? ... gIJM_D_BwE
Tidy https://tidy.sourceforge.net/
HTML Validator online (line by line) https://validator.w3.org/
Just export to HTML, open the bookmarks.html file in any of these utilities, make any minor change (forces a refresh) and save it. I just add Kom to my file names to identify it has been cleaned by KompoZer -- I like it best.
Then delete all your bookmarks, then import from this new HTML file.
